T V Sundram Iyengar and Sons Limited

T V Sundram Iyengar and Sons Limited

211, NH7
South Veli Street
Madurai 625007

+91-452-4356300, 4356400

+91-9944412691

Related Companies

Business Reviews for T V Sundram Iyengar and Sons Limited